Is €950,000 a fair price for this apartment?

The asking price of €950,000 is above the neighbourhood median of €515,000, but this apartment is also much larger than average (153 m² vs 114 m²). The price per m² works out to about €6,209, which is below the neighbourhood average of €7,587 per m². So while the total price is high, you get more space for your money compared to other homes in Vissershaven.

Heat stress is how much the immediate area heats up extra on warm days: a lot of stone, asphalt and little greenery retain heat, making it feel noticeably warmer than outside built-up areas. The 2050 projection assumes the high climate scenario. Source: Klimaateffectatlas.
